AAEON SBC-590 CPU Board. Full-size | PCI/ISA | Pentium CPU Card with SVGA Simple Type: CPU Board
The SBC-590 is an all-in-one single board Pentium computer with an on-board SVGA controller, with PCI-bus and ISA-bus support . It packs all the functions of an industrial computer with display capabilities on a single full-size card. The SBC-590 is fully PC/AT compatible, so your software will run without modifications. The on-board PCI-bus SVGA controller uses the ALG 2032 chipset with 1 MB shared memory. This chipset, used with the local PCI-bus, enables 32-bit graphic throughput and has a built-in Standard Feature Connector. These features make the SBC-590 particularly suited for graphics intensive applications. Another feature of the SBC-590 is the inclusion of a high speed local bus IDE controller. This controller supports (through ATA PIO) mode 3 and mode 4 hard disks, which enables data transfer rates in excess of 11 MB/sec. Up to four IDE devices can be connected, including large hard disks, CD-ROM drives, tape backup drives or other IDE devices. The built-in enhanced IDE controller provides a 4-layer 32-bit posted write-buffer and a 4-layer 32-bit read prefetch to accomplish the IDE boost in performace improvements. On-board features also include two high-speed RS-232 serial ports with 16C550 UARTs, one bidirectional SPP/EPP/ECP parallel port and a floppy drive controller. In addition to the Pentium's 16 KB of on-chip cache memory, the SBC-590 comes with an extra 256 KB or 512 KB of second level memory on-board. If program execution is halted by a program bug or EMI, the board's 16-stage watchdog timer can automatically reset the CPU or generate an interrupt, provided the watchdog timer has been programmed in advance. This ensures reliability in unmanned or stand-alone systems. The SBC-590 supports 5V EDO DRAM. It also provides four 72-pin SIMM (Single In-line Memory Module) sockets for its on-board system DRAM. These sockets give you the flexibility to configure your system from 1 MB to 128 MB of DRAM using the most economical combination of SIMMs.

Features
- "Green" function, supports power management
- 100% PC/AT-compatible PCI/ISA-bus CPU card
- Accepts Intel Pentium 75-200 MHz CPUs and other compatible CPUs like Cyrix 6x86 and AMD 5k86 CPUs at 66/60/50/40 MHz (external clock speed)
- Built-in, fast PCI enhanced IDE controller supports four IDE devices (large HDDs, CD-ROM, tape backup, etc.)
- Connectors for PC/104 module expansion
- On-board 32-bit PCI-bus SVGA controller
- On-board keyboard and PS/2 mouse connector
- One enhanced bi-directional parallel port. Supports SPP/EPP/ECP
- Supports 5 V EDO DRAM, up to 128 MB of DRAM
- Supports a Feature Connector
- Supports pipeline burst RAM module
- Two high-speed serial RS-232 ports (16C550 UARTs with 16-byte FIFO). IRQ 3, 4 or IRQ 10, 11 can be individually selected
- Watchdog timer (64 steps, 1 second per step)
Specifications
- Bidirectional parallel port: Configurable to LPT1, LPT2, LPT3 or disabled. Supports SPP/EPP/ECP standards
- BIOS: Award BIOS
- Board size: 13.3" (L) x 4.8" (W) (338 mm x 122 mm)
- Board weight: 1.2 lbs (0.5 Kg)
- Bus interface: ISA and PCI (PC/AT) bus
- Bus speed: 8 MHz for ISA bus; 20/25/30/33 MHz (for PCI bus) dependent upon CPU clock speed
- Chipset: VT 82C575/82C576/82C577
- CPU: Intel Pentium 75-200 MHz CPUs and other compatible CPUs at 66/60/50/40 MHz (external clock speed)
- Data bus: 64 bit
- Display controller: SVGA, PCI-bus, ALG 2032 chipset with 1 MB shared video memory. Provides 32-bit graphic through-put. Supports resolutions up to 1280 x 1024 in 16 colors, 1024 x 768 in 256 colors,
- DMA channels: 7
- Driver interface: Large hard disk drives or other enhanced IDE devices. Supports mode 3 and mode 4 hard disks (data transfer rate, minimum of 11.1 MB/sec)
- Enhanced IDE hard disk: Fast PCI bus. Supports up to four enhanced IDE (ATA-2)
- Feature connector: 26-pin header for external VGA Display
- Floppy disk drive interface: Supports up to two floppy disk drives, 5.25" (360 KB and 1.2 MB) and/or 3.5" (720 KB, 1.44 and 2.88 MB)
- Interrupt levels: 15
- Keyboard or PS/2 mouse connector: A 6-pin mini DIN keyboard connector is located on the mounting bracket for easy access to the keyboard and PS/2 mouse.
- L2 Cache memory size: 256 KB/512 KB 2nd level cache memory (Supports pipeline burst SRAM module)
- Max. power requirements: +5 V @ 5 A
- Operating temperature: 32 to 140oF (0 to 60oC)
- PC/104: 104-pin connector for a 16-bit bus
- Power supply voltage: +5 V (4.75 V to 5.25 V)
- Processing ability: 64 bit
- Processor: Intel Pentium
- RAM memory: 1 MB to 128 MB. Uses four 72-pin SIMM sockets supporting EDO RAM
- Serial ports: Two serial RS-232 ports; use 16C550 UARTs with 16-byte FIFO buffer. Supports speeds up to 115 Kbps. Ports can be individually configured from COM1 to COM4 or disabled.
- Shadow RAM memory: Supports system and video BIOS shadow memory
- Watchdog timer: Can generate a system reset or IRQ15. The time interval is software selectable from 1 to 64 seconds.
